In a letter dated June 22, 1946, George B. Schwabe, a member of the House of Representatives, expresses his gratitude to Giles A. Penick, Jr., for his support in eliminating the O.P.A. and passing the Case Bill. Schwabe explains his stance on these issues and mentions his friendship with Penick's father. Penick had previously written to Schwabe on June 19, 1946, congratulating him on his efforts and expressing his hope for the enactment of the Case Bill.
